Environmental engineers and scientists are becoming concerned about pharmaceuticals in the environment. An antibiotic is discharged into a small lake at an influent concentration of 0.05 mg/L. The lake has a surface area of 1.5 acres and a mean depth of 6 feet. The flow into the river is 100 cubic feet per second (cfs). The antibiotic is degraded naturally in the lake with a first-order rate constant of 0.003 s-1.
A. What kind of hydrodynamic model should you use for a small lake?
B. Write the mass balance equation in words.
C. Write the mass balance equation for the antibiotic in symbols at steady state. Define your symbols.
D. What is the antibiotic concentration in a river draining the lake at steady state?
